Dense planting is an effective strategy for weed seed prevention because it minimizes the space available for weeds to grow by crowding out unwanted plants. By creating a dense canopy, this method reduces sunlight reaching the soil, thereby inhibiting weed seed germination and growth.
How Does Dense Planting Prevent Weed Growth?
Dense planting works by maximizing the use of available space and resources, which leaves little room for weeds to thrive. When plants are closely packed, they create a thick canopy that blocks sunlight from reaching the soil surface. Since many weed seeds require light to germinate, this shading effect significantly reduces weed emergence.
- Resource Competition: Dense planting ensures that desirable plants occupy most of the soil nutrients and moisture, leaving less for weeds.
- Reduced Sunlight: A closed canopy prevents sunlight from reaching the ground, which is crucial for the germination of many weed species.
- Quick Coverage: Fast-growing cover crops can quickly blanket the soil, outpacing weed growth and suppressing their development.
What Are the Benefits of Dense Planting?
Implementing dense planting in your garden or farm can yield numerous benefits beyond weed control. Here’s how:
- Enhanced Soil Health: Dense planting promotes a diverse root system that improves soil structure and fertility.
- Increased Yield: With less competition from weeds, your crops can grow more robustly, potentially increasing overall yield.
- Biodiversity: A variety of plants in close proximity can support beneficial insects and improve pollination.
- Reduced Herbicide Use: By naturally suppressing weeds, dense planting can decrease reliance on chemical weed control methods.
Practical Examples of Dense Planting
Dense planting can be adapted to various gardening and farming scenarios. Here are some practical examples:
- Companion Planting: Growing plants like marigolds alongside vegetables can deter pests and suppress weeds.
- Cover Crops: Planting rye or clover between crop cycles can prevent weed growth and improve soil health.
- Intercropping: Combining crops like corn and beans can maximize space and reduce weed pressure.
Key Considerations for Successful Dense Planting
While dense planting offers many advantages, it’s essential to consider several factors to ensure success:
- Plant Selection: Choose plants that thrive in close proximity and have compatible growth habits.
- Soil Quality: Ensure that the soil is fertile enough to support closely planted crops.
- Water Management: Monitor moisture levels to prevent competition stress among plants.

What Are the Disadvantages of Dense Planting?
While dense planting can be beneficial, it may lead to increased competition for resources among plants, potentially resulting in lower yields if not managed properly. It can also lead to higher humidity levels, which may promote fungal diseases.
Can Dense Planting Be Used in Small Gardens?
Yes, dense planting is particularly effective in small gardens where space is limited. By optimizing plant spacing and using vertical growing techniques, gardeners can maximize productivity and minimize weeds.
How Does Dense Planting Affect Soil Erosion?
Dense planting helps reduce soil erosion by stabilizing the soil with a network of roots and minimizing bare ground exposure. This can be particularly beneficial on slopes or areas prone to erosion.
What Crops Are Best for Dense Planting?
Leafy greens, root vegetables, and legumes are excellent choices for dense planting due to their ability to grow well in close quarters. Fast-growing cover crops like clover and rye are also effective for weed suppression.
How Can I Transition to Dense Planting in My Garden?
Start by gradually increasing plant density in a small section of your garden. Experiment with different plant combinations and monitor their growth. Adjust watering and fertilization practices to accommodate the increased plant density.
